Leo Artzner's Obituary
Leo William Artzner (67) passed away in his sleep on March 17, 2025, in Broken Arrow, Oklahoma. Born February 25, 1958, in Cleveland Ohio. He eventually moved to Florida where he had two children, Alexandra and Nicholas Artzner. He moved to Oklahoma to pursue his love for traveling and seeing the United States and became a cross-country truck driver. He was able to visit all the states except Hawaii and Alaska. He loved fishing, hunting, the woods, Native American Indian culture and being outdoors. Leo would often catch people off guard with his quick wit and perfectly timed remarks. His sarcasm was legendary, but those who knew him well understood that it was just one of the many ways he expressed his deep affection for those around him. Beneath the tough exterior was a man who cherished the moments of quiet connection and the joy of a good adventure. Leo will be remembered not just for his sarcastic one-liners and his love for the outdoors, but for the way he lived life on his own terms. He was a man who made an impression with every word, every action, and every moment. Though he may have kept his emotions close, his legacy will live on through the countless memories shared with family, friends, and all who had the pleasure of knowing him. He leaves behind his children, Alexandra and Nicholas. Granddaughter, Ella (Alexandra). His sisters Anita and Mary Ellen. Brothers Jim and Rick. Several nieces, nephews and great nieces and great nephews. He will be dearly missed by his simplicity in life.
